云服务器怎么监听端口
在云计算时代,云服务器已经成为了企业数据中心的重要组成部分。在使用云服务器的过程中,我们不可避免地需要对其进行端口监听。本文将介绍云服务器如何监听端口。
1. 开启防火墙
在云服务器上监听端口之前,需要确保服务器开启了防火墙。防火墙是一项重要的安全措施,可以防止非法访问和攻击。在Linux系统下,可以使用iptables命令来开启防火墙。例如,下面的命令可以开启22端口(SSH端口):
iptables -A INPUT -p tcp --dport 22 -j ACCEPT
2. 监听端口
在开启防火墙之后,就可以开始监听端口了。在Linux系统下,可以使用netstat命令来查看当前监听的端口。例如,下面的命令可以查看当前监听的所有端口:
netstat -an | grep LISTEN
如果需要监听新的端口,可以使用以下命令:
nc -l 8080
其中8080是要监听的端口号。
3. 配置端口转发
在云服务器上监听端口时,有时需要将请求转发到其他服务器。这时需要配置端口转发。在Linux系统下,可以使用iptables命令来配置端口转发。例如,下面的命令可以将80端口的请求转发到192.168.1.100服务器的80端口:
iptables -t nat -A PREROUTING -p tcp --dport 80 -j DNAT --to-destination 192.168.1.100:80
总结
以上就是云服务器监听端口的方法。在使用云服务器时,要注意安全问题,并开启防火墙。如果需要监听新的端口,可以使用netstat命令或nc命令。如果需要配置端口转发,可以使用iptables命令。